The Who Reschedule North American Tour Dates for 2016

September 29, 2015

The Who have announced their tour dates for The Who Hits 50! North American Tour 2016, which will include rescheduled dates from the late-2015 leg of the tour. The band previously announced that they were postponing all dates from September into December due to a case of viral meningitis contracted by singer Roger Daltrey. 

With Daltrey purportedly on the mend, the legendary band will relaunch their North American tour starting February 27 in Detroit. The dates will take The Who around the US and into Canada, with a final run down the West Coast and the closing date in Las Vegas on May 29. View the full tour schedule below.
